WOWS Kids Fiji today received $10,600 through the University of the South Pacific’s Shave a Hero, Save a Hero campaign.

USP’s vice-chancellor and president Professor Pal Ahluwalia acknowledged the institution’s Human Resources’ department for taking the lead role in organising the event.

“I believe this is a great way for us to give back to our communities, especially since we’re in the festive season,” Prof Ahluwalia said.

The initiative saw four USP staff members who were nominated and pledged to raise $1000 each to determine whether they would save or shave their hair.

USP staff Viliamu Iese and Prashila Narayan did not reach the required target but willingly shaved their hair today to show their support towards WOWS Kids Fiji.

USP also handed over gifts for the children at WOWS Kids Fiji.
